For the last couple of weeks one of our tasks was to redesign the front page of Wikidot. The goal was to make it clear, simple, informative and easy to navigate. As always. After a couple of iterations and designs that have never seen the daylight, we would like to show you a "sneak peek preview" of how the main page of Wikidot will look like within a few weeks. We are planning to change the design simultaneously with the introduction of paid services (more information later).
The preview is currently available at testtheme.wikidot.com, our temporary testing site.
We are still working on the content, so please do not take it as final. But we really would like to share our vision with you and hear your opinions and suggestions!

Showing AdSense ads to anonymous users only

Today we are introducing a feature that has been suggested by many users who either use our AdSense integration or are looking into it. Just a word to those who are not familiar with it: we are allowing our users to put AdSense ads on their pages and we share revenue with them. This is done through AdSense API, a program from Google that makes such integration a piece of cake. When you are using AdSense with Wikidot, Google pays you directly based on the number of clicks in your ads and some other "magic" factors.

Anyway, the problem some of you have is:
- You want to display ads on your Wikis and earn money. This is obvious.
- You do not want to discourage regular users and members by exposing to ads. This is especially important on community wikis, forums etc.
We have performed a study on a selected number of sites. Our solution, very simple, is that now you can display AdSense ads only to users without a Wikidot.com account (aka anonymous users). Why can this benefit you?
- Some of the Wikidot users appreciate the fact that Wikidot is ad-free by default. Most likely they would also appreciate your Wiki as ad-free too, especially if it is a community site, like a forum.
- Regular users do not click ads — this is called ad blindness. If they visit your site often, at some point they simply ignore the ads.
- So you are not likely to make much money from them at all (our study shows that on average only 5% of clicks come from registered users).
- On the other hand your regular users can contribute vastly to the number of pageviews, up to 80-90% on community sites like forums.
- This together makes your ad perform terribly in terms of click per impression ratio (CTR).
- Anonymous users, that come from search engines (like Google) contribute about 50% to the total number of visits. Anonymous users generate up to 90% of earnings today on some wikis.
- By disabling ads for your regular users you can improve performance of your ads and (magically!) this can vastly improve you total earnings.
So the most important benefits of displaying ads to the anonymous users only are:
- Browsing your Site is now nicer for registered users (no ads).
- Improve performance of your ads (if you are lost in our explanation above, just try this).
- Can improve your overall earnings!
We highly recommend setting this option to everyone. In fact, the ads are being displayed to anonymous users only by default now. If you do not like it, you can change it back. Simply go to the AdSense panel and click on configure wikis, but please give it a try for a while.
If you are deep into AdSense, probably you already know that many services are using such an distinction between visitors with very good results.
If you have never used our AdSense options, now there is one more reason to try it. Your regular users will not be exposed to ads, so they should not mind at all, but you could get some nice pocket money!
